Prompt
A close-up of the inside of an incense burner. The burner is made of coarse pottery or cast iron, filled with years of accumulated incense ash—extremely fine light gray powder, its surface gently smoothed into gentle mounds but still retaining subtle irregularities. Several burnt-out incense sticks are inserted into the ash, varying in length and angle; one is currently burning, its tip a dark red point, a wisp of extremely fine white smoke rising straight up then curving and dispersing in the air. There are a few slightly concave areas on the ash surface from previous burnings. A small amount of spilled ash clings to the outer rim of the burner. The surroundings are dark wood and rough earthen walls, with dim light. Avoid: arranging the incense ash into perfect geometric shapes, emptying the burner to leave only new ash, adding multiple incense sticks burning simultaneously, using bright lighting.
